## Dates render in the wrong locale

If Tidemark shows US-style dates for European tenants, the locale header is usually being stripped by the edge cache. Confirm the tenant's locale in the admin panel, then purge the cached render bundle and reload. To call the localization endpoint directly while debugging, authenticate your requests with the bearer token that follows.

session JWT of hahif-fawif = eyJhbGciOiJIUzI1NiIsInR5cCI6IkpXVCJ9.eyJzdWIiOiI04_V2KayaDIn0.-jKHPhS5t5LS

Runbook: Vramscope GPU memory profiler — access notes for review. Vramscope attaches to training jobs on the Keldra cluster and samples allocator state every 500ms. It runs unprivileged, reads only the driver's telemetry interface, and writes profiles to a restricted bucket with 14-day retention. No process memory is dumped; only allocation metadata is captured. Operators enable it per-job via a flag, never globally. For the audit, the profiler's deployed configuration is recorded below.

deployment values, yadug-bawif:
[framir]
team = pelox
access_code = ac_a38ab2
owner = tamion.julael
host = framir.tolvaqlabs.test
port = 11211
peer = tammir.zemvargrid.local
salt = 2215ef03
pin = 1541

CI note for weekly sync: the Fennelwick data-retention sweeper started failing on the nightly pipeline Tuesday. Root cause was a stale manifest in the purge-candidates stage — the sweeper read last quarter's retention policy and tried to delete rows still under legal hold, which tripped the safety interlock and failed the job. Marta patched the manifest loader to validate policy timestamps before execution. Fix is merged and the nightly run is green again. The passing run is traceable under the token below.

build token for kagaf-hahof: htk14_9d3d4d26d7d8de